2010-11: Suffered an injury prior to the season, did not see any game action. Transferred to Tulane for 2011-12 and played his fifth year for the Green Wave.
2009-10: (Game-by-Game in PDF) Played in all 28 games, making five starts ... Finished third on the team with 200 points (7.1 ppg) ... Second among Penn players with 109 rebounds (3.9 rpg) ... Third on the team with 24 steals, fourth with 45 assists ... Finished season with 10 double-figure scoring games and one double-double ... Finished season with 14 points and seven rebounds at Princeton (3/9) ... Had consecutive 14-point games in final Ivy weekend, vs. Harvard (3/5) and Dartmouth (3/6) ... Also had seven rebounds and two steals vs. the Crimson ... Scored team-high 17 points at Columbia (2/26) ... In first collegiate start, recorded his first collegiate double-double with 18 points and 12 rebounds, added four assists vs. Yale (2/20) ... Had team-leading 19 points, eight rebounds, two assists and two steals in 32 minutes at Harvard (2/6) ... Had back-to-back 11 point games in first Ivy weekend, at Yale (1/29) and Brown (1/30) ... Final bucket at Brown was a putback at the buzzer that gave Penn a 55-54 win ... Also had 12 combined rebounds that weekend ... Scored 10 points and had four assists against Temple (1/13) ... First double-figure scoring game came in Penn's first win, at UMBC (1/6) ... Notched five points and six rebounds at both Navy (12/4) and Monmouth (12/12).
2008-09: (Game-by-Game in PDF) Played in 12 games, averaging 4.1 minutes ... Scored in Ivy League games against Cornell (3/6) and Brown (2/13) ... Also had four rebounds against the Big Red and two against the Bears ... Had an assist, a block and a steal at Dartmouth (1/31) ... Also had assists against Harvard (1/30) and Temple (1/14).
2007-08: (Game-by-Game in PDF) Played in 11 games ... Saw 20 minutes at Brown (3/8) and came up with five points and team-leading six rebounds ... Three points, two boards, two assists and two blocked shots in 15 minutes against Saint Joseph's (1/19) ... Had six points at Miami, Fla. (1/2) ... First collegiate points came against No. 1 North Carolina (12/4) ... In collegiate debut, had a rebound, a block and two steals in three minutes at Loyola, Md. (11/11).
High School: Three-year letterwinner in both basketball and football ... Captain of both ... High school basketball coaches were John Meyer and Scott Nemecek ... Basketball team won regional title in 2006 and Central Suburban League (CSL) titles in 2005 and 2006 ... Named all-conference in 2005-06 ... Earned all-conference honors in football for CSL champions as a senior ... Honor roll student.
Personal: Son of Mary and Daniel Monckton ... Father played basketball at William & Mary ... Uncle, Tony Lehman, played basketball at Miami (Ohio) and was a McDonald's All-Star in high school ... Enrolled in the College of Arts and Sciences.
